## Vendor: Lanternfold Mailworks

Lanternfold handles our donation-receipt mailer for the Thistledown Fund. Contract renews each March; SLA is 24h delivery, 99.5% uptime on their API. Templates live in our repo under `mail/receipts`; Lanternfold only renders and sends. Do not let them edit copy directly — all changes go through our review. Invoices arrive monthly. For template bugs, delivery failures, or renewal questions, contact their account desk at the address below.

alerts address for kajog-tadup: druox@plorvanet.internal

## Ownership

The clock-skew monitor for the Quarrylight build farm lives in this repo. Build agents occasionally drift more than the 250ms tolerance, which breaks artifact timestamp ordering and causes the Slatebird scheduler to mark runs as flaky. If support sees skew alerts, first check the NTP sidecar logs, then escalate rather than restarting agents manually — restarts mask the drift without fixing it. Questions about the monitor, its thresholds, or the escalation path go to the component owner listed below.

account owner for kagag-yahap: Novath Quenok

# Environments — `stringsift` extraction script

The stringsift script walks the Varrow UI codebase and extracts translatable strings into per-locale catalogs. It runs differently per environment: dry-run in dev, full extraction in staging, and read-only verification in prod. Each mode is selected entirely through configuration, so review carefully the values listed below.

config for kafof-bawef:
holath:
  log_level: debug
  metrics_host: metrics.holath.qorvelsys.internal
  pin: 2191
  pool_size: 32